Episode 5: A Bus Crush

[Scene: Morning – On the Bus]

Days passed, and Elina had slowly moved on from Yuto. Her crush on him had faded, and she was focusing on her studies again. But life had a way of surprising her. One morning, while traveling to school on the bus, she noticed a boy sitting a few rows ahead. He looked calm, handsome, and… different. From the moment she got on the bus, his eyes seemed to find her.

Elina felt it — a strange, new feeling. She could feel when someone is looking at her, and this boy’s gaze was different. It was not teasing, not rude, not even casual. His eyes were pure, soft, and focused, as if he was seeing her for the first time and truly appreciating her.

For the entire journey, from the start station to the last stop, they didn’t talk. Not a single word. But Elina could feel something stirring inside her — a tiny spark of curiosity, of excitement. His presence was calm yet captivating. Every glance made her cheeks warm, and her heart beat a little faster.

Elina (FC) [thinking]: Wow… why do I feel this way? His eyes… they feel so kind.

[Scene: On the Bus – Journey]

Elina tried to look out the window, pretending she wasn’t aware of him. But she couldn’t stop sneaking glances. He was handsome, yes, but there was something more — a softness in his gaze, a quiet, pure intention that made her feel safe and noticed.

From the start of the bus ride, he didn’t break eye contact completely. Sometimes, he looked away quickly when she noticed him staring, but the moment she looked back, his eyes found hers again. For Elina, it was a new, exciting feeling. Her mind kept imagining small things — like him smiling, greeting her, or even just sitting near her.

Elina (FC) [thinking]: Could this be… another crush? But… it feels different.

[Scene: Last Station – Goodbye]

Finally, it was her stop. Elina’s heart felt heavy — she didn’t want the ride to end. As she got up and walked toward the door, she noticed him move closer to the window, trying to show her something, maybe his phone number or just a smile. Elina wanted to reach out too, but the moment passed.

They shared one last look, and both smiled at each other. That small, simple smile felt like a whole conversation. It was innocent, warm, and left a mark in her heart. Elina stepped out of the bus, feeling a little flutter in her chest. She knew this boy, whoever he was, had left a lasting impression.

As she walked away, she couldn’t stop thinking about the bus ride. She realized this was another crush — one of those pure, sweet, quiet crushes that made her heart beat faster without any words spoken.

Elina (FC) [thinking]: Another crush… but it feels nice. Calm, soft, and… exciting.

Elina smiled to herself, hugging her school bag a little tighter. Life seemed full of little surprises. Crushes could appear anywhere — in stores, on buses, or even in fleeting moments. And maybe that was what made them so special.
